#8a5360 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8a5360 is composed of 54.1% red, 32.5%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.9% magenta, 30.4%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 345.8 degrees, a saturation of 24.9% and a lightness of 43.3%. #8a5360 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6c0 with #150000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#8a5360

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030202 is the darkest color, while #faf6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8a5360

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716d6d is the less saturated color, while #d70738 is the most saturated one.
